SWS DTC Troubleshooting: 16-11, 16-12, 16-13, 16-14

DTC 16-11:

Short to Power in the Front Passenger's Weight Sensor (rear inner side) Power Circuit

DTC 16-12:

Short to Ground in the Front Passenger's Weight Sensor (rear inner side) Power Circuit

DTC 16-13:

Open in the Front Passenger's Weight Sensor (rear inner side) Output Circuit

DTC 16-14:

Short to Ground in the Front Passenger's Weight Sensor (rear inner side) Output Circuit

NOTE:

- Before doing this troubleshooting procedure, find out if the vehicle was in a collision. If so, verify that all the required components were replaced with new components, of the correct part number, and that they were properly installed Service and Repair.
- Only read DTCs from the SRS menu, not from SWS menus unless instructed to check SWS DTCs. SWS (ODS unit) DTCs are subcodes of SRS DTCs. Only troubleshoot the corresponding SRS DTCs. These SWS DTCs are cleared when you turn the ignition switch to LOCK (0).

Do the troubleshooting for SRS DTC 82-16 82-16.
